I have Swift 3 Acer with Acer Care Center preinstalled. Many times i check for driver updates and critical updates via Acer Care center, but unfortunately, it always shows No updates available for the system. Is it that my Care Center is NOT working properly or somebody else is also having the same problem. Moreover, its really annoying to check driver updates if any own its own or through a windows update, as many updates are OEM modified, Can anybody suggests an easy way to keep my laptop driver updated which are approved or released by Acer only.

    There are some bugs in acer care centre so, don't use acer care centre. It always shows no update available or keep loading

    1)You can update gpu driver from official manufacturer driver site
    (E.g.-if you have Amd gpu then go to Amd driver site, if you have Nvidia gpu then go Nvidia driver site)

    2)if you want to update other device driver like wifi, Bluetooth etc
    Then right click on window icon→open device manager
    Now, one by one expand and right click on device driver→update driver→search automatically for update.........
    (Eg- if you want to update wifi driver then open device manager→expand network adapters→right click on wireless wifi driver→update driver→search automatically............)
